The DC Defenders and St. Louis Battlehawks are set to clash in a thrilling Week 3 UFL matchup on Sunday, April 13, 2025, at The Dome at America’s Center in St. Louis, Missouri. Kickoff is scheduled for 3:00 PM ET. Both teams are undefeated, making this game a battle for early-season supremacy in the XFL Conference.

Team Overview
DC Defenders (2-0): The Defenders have started the season strong, securing victories against the Birmingham Stallions (18-11) in Week 1 and the Memphis Showboats (17-12) in Week 2. Known for their gritty defense and efficient offense, DC has relied on quarterback Jordan Ta’amu’s leadership and a balanced attack to control games. Their defense has been particularly impressive, allowing just 11.5 points per game.
St. Louis Battlehawks (2-0): The Battlehawks have been dominant in their first two games, defeating the Houston Roughnecks (31-6) in Week 1 and the San Antonio Brahmas (26-9) in Week 2. St. Louis boasts one of the league’s most explosive offenses, averaging 28.5 points per game, while their defense has been equally formidable, allowing only 7.5 points per game. Running back Jacob Saylors has been a standout performer, leading the league in rushing touchdowns.
Key Players to Watch
DC Defenders:
Jordan Ta’amu: The quarterback has thrown for 363 yards, two touchdowns, and one interception, completing 46% of his passes. Ta’amu’s ability to manage the game and make key plays under pressure will be crucial.
Chris Rowland: Rowland has been a reliable target, recording six receptions for 106 yards and one touchdown. His ability to stretch the field adds a dynamic element to DC’s offense.
Abram Smith: The running back has rushed for 99.5 yards per game, providing balance to the Defenders’ offense.
St. Louis Battlehawks:
Jacob Saylors: Saylors has been a force in the running game, rushing for 144 yards and four touchdowns in two games. His ability to break through defenses will be a key factor.
Manny Wilkins: Wilkins has been efficient, completing 76.3% of his passes for 351 yards. While he hasn’t thrown a touchdown yet, his accuracy and decision-making have kept the Battlehawks’ offense moving.
Jarveon Howard: Howard has contributed 128 rushing yards and one touchdown, complementing Saylors in the backfield.
Matchup Analysis
Offense: St. Louis has averaged 389.5 yards per game, significantly outpacing DC’s 277.0 yards per game. The Battlehawks’ ability to sustain drives and capitalize on scoring opportunities gives them an edge.
Defense: Both teams boast strong defenses, with DC allowing just 217.5 yards per game and St. Louis conceding 196.5 yards per game. The Battlehawks’ ability to limit big plays and control the line of scrimmage will be key.
Rushing Game: St. Louis has dominated on the ground, averaging 218.5 rushing yards per game, while DC has averaged 99.5. The Battlehawks’ rushing attack, led by Saylors and Howard, could be the deciding factor.
